I'm not sure what else I can add to the many, many reviews out there about this book.
It wrapped me up in its world, though there was some moments where the strength of the narrative wavered for me. For most of the book, she was right below the line of being "too much" but the final battle was definitely "too much."
I have high hopes that the remaining books in the trilogy will explore ways of rebelling against the Capitol. I wish that had been a bigger thread throughout this book--it was there, but it would have been a stronger book if they had fought each other and The Man at the same time.
Glad I finally joined the bandwagon and read it--and will certainly read the sequel.
